Armenia's government allocates 3.14 billion drams to fulfill obligations to exporters

The export support program covers agricultural products and alcoholic beverages

The Armenian government has decided to allocate 3.14 billion drams to fulfill its obligations to exporters during a cabinet meeting on July 9. Minister of Economy Gevork Papoyan noted that since June, the government has been implementing measures to diversify markets.

As part of this program, financial support is provided to entrepreneurs for the export of agricultural products, flowers, and certain types of alcoholic beverages.

Papoyan added that in June, 784 tons of peppers, 200 tons of tomatoes, 103 tons of strawberries, 3,000 tons of apricots, 1,400 tons of cherries, 1.5 million liters of mineral water, 2,800 liters of grape wine, and 1.3 million liters of other alcoholic products were exported.

Thus, in June and July, Armenian fruits were exported to 15 countries, flowers to 25 countries, and vegetables to 8 countries.

Prime Minister Nikol Pashinyan noted that the presented figures indicate that the balanced policy of the authorities is yielding results.
